Output 4ef313149f3d4f5d79cdb7736a80396c27b1a7c97e149e1f675601603c06742e: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ec4eb0b36da826a494a66d7c43a4901899c58ec OP_EQUALVERIFY OP_CHECKSIG
address
1E1trMRbwahGr5KESKR4imm5ar6MDyii4A
transaction
4ef313149f3d4f5d79cdb7736a80396c27b1a7c97e149e1f675601603c06742e
spent
true